Home Instead (Retford and Gainsborough) specialise in providing person-centred home care services which help older people to remain independent in their own homes.

Professional Care Pros are carefully chosen for their compassion and empathy, are fully trained and vetted and are personally matched to each client.

Home visits are extremely flexible and range from help for a few hours a day to ‘24-hour’ care, which includes weekends and bank holidays.

Services are tailored to service users’ requirements and can include personal care, home help, companionship services and specialised services for people living with dementia.

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.9 (9.908) out of 10 for Home Instead (Retford and Gainsborough) is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  1. The Average Rating is 4.9 out of 5 from 13 Reviews in the last 24 months.
  2. The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 13 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Home Care Provider is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  1. 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months. The Average Rating of 4.908 for Home Instead (Retford and Gainsborough) is calculated as follows: ( (69 Excellents x 5) + (7 Goods x 4) ) ÷ 76 Ratings = 4.908
  2. 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5').

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ows: 3 points for the first Positive Review, 2 points in total for each of the next 9 Positive Reviews (1st = 3, 2nd = 0.5, 3rd = 0.5, 4th = 0.25, 5th = 0.25, 6th = 0.1, 7th = 0.1, 8th = 0.1, 9th = 0.1, 10th = 0.1)

    The 5 points relating to the number of Positive Reviews for Home Instead (Retford and Gainsborough) is based on 13 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as follows: 3 + 0.5 + 0.5 + 0.25 + 0.25 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 5
  3. When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.
  4. If a Home Care Provider does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
